Wiring Diagrams
DCX 3400 Series
PRIMARY USES: DVR/HD-DVR, MR-DVR Server DCT
1. Video outputs / YPbPr—Component video
output (HDTV)
2. Audio Out—L/R audio (SDTV)
3. Audio Out—Variable L/R audio (SDTV)
4. Digital Audio (Coaxial S/PDIF)—Provides
Dolby® Digital or PCM output. Digital Audio
(Optical S/PDIF)—Provides Dolby® Digital or
PCM output
5. Inserted M-Card (Multi-Room DVR)
6. Cable In—Connects to cable signal
7.
RF Out—Ch 3/4 modulated audio/video
(SDTV) to TV, DVD recorder or VCR
8. IEEE-1394—(Not active)

1. USB 2.0 High-Speed connector (Not Active)
2. Cursor—Menu navigation; Select—Selects menu options
3. Power—Turns the set-top on and off (standby)
4. Menu—Displays the menu
5. Guide—Displays the program guide
6. Info—Displays current channel and program information
7.
Format *—Change the video output format
8. Channel—Changes channel up or down
* Availability of certain features is dependent upon application support.
9. Video Out—Composite Video (SDTV)
10. S-Video—Connects to S-Video (SDTV) input
of TV, DVD recorder or VCR
11. HDMI—High-Definition TV (HDTV) connec-
tor
12. eSATA—External Serial ATA disk interface
(Not Active)
13. USB 2.0—High-Speed peripheral device
connection (Not active)
14. External IR Input—Connects to a remote
control set-top accessory cable
15. Ethernet — Network connection
16. Power connector
